Output 4e65d81cc6ceef54c25a9c62297a24a89c3b2460e67c2af6d25bf5ef0cf35677:0

value
16556081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da12aad59c0463c5da00777f989253dd9e251e0 OP_EQUAL
address
32w5n6ZauyuJJVysUoVPdweDWTALKUrnNm
transaction
4e65d81cc6ceef54c25a9c62297a24a89c3b2460e67c2af6d25bf5ef0cf35677
confirmations
323549
spent
true